QUOTE(Felice821 @ Feb 28 2012, 02:46 PM)
you need to fulfill the pre-requisite of ...

35 PDU
4500 working experience
36 months experince in Project Management
Degree Holder

PMP not only for a Project Manager, a lot of PMP certified is not a PM neither.

You can either attending PMP course which will grant you a 35PDU or purchase Online Course which will grant you the same amount of PDU as well.

Once you got your 35PDU and fulfill all the pre-requisite, you can register and schedule for your exam.
Are u sure u dont need to be a PM to enrol on the PMP program? The requirements clearly state that you need between 4,500 and 7,500 hours leading and directing projects in order to qualify to sit for the exam.

I kinda agree with you. But bear in mind that one of the pre-requisite for PMP exam is 35-hour of contact with appointed education partner (i.e. those offering the PMP classes). without that, one can't even sit for the exam. at the end of the day, they also need money to run what they have been doing brows.gif

Before one joins any class, please do check they are PMI appointed partner via PMI.org. Nowadays there are lots of scam on the internet smile.gif

Me myself have attended one of those conventiional, face-to-face lecturer led PMP course in a local IT training company. Role Play/hands-on sessions and lunch is provided. RM7000 per course.
